BERLIN (Reuters: Tesla (NASDAQ) is concerned that it will not be able hire enough workers to staff its factory in Berlin. This was stated by Elon Musk, chief executive, at a Saturday festival, which took place on site of the plant. The stream, live on social media, was recorded on Saturday.
Musk also stated that he hopes the plant will in future produce Tesla’s trucks. He added that staff from Europe would be welcome to join him at the plant.
“We are concerned that there won’t be enough talent. He said that we need to attract great talent from Europe.
